Aesthetic Versatility and Customization

Square aluminum profiles are not only functional but also aesthetically pleasing. Innovations have expanded the range of surface treatments, colors, and finishes available. Anodizing, powder coating, and other techniques allow architects and designers to create profiles that complement any architectural style. Additionally, custom extrusion capabilities enable the production of profiles with intricate shapes and sizes, offering endless possibilities for customization and unique design concepts.

Sustainability and Environmental Benefits

Sustainability has become a key consideration in modern construction practices. Square aluminum profiles contribute to environmental sustainability in several ways. Aluminum is a highly recyclable material, and the recycling process requires minimal energy input. Additionally, the durability of aluminum profiles reduces the need for frequent replacements, minimizing waste and conserving natural resources.
